Add Event In Facebook


- Click Events under the Explore area of the left hand sidebar.

- Click the blue Create Event switch.

- A dropdown menu will appear permitting you to Create a private or public Event. Make your choice. The following steps will be nearly similar no matter your selection, yet you can't change personal privacy settings after developing an event.

- Fill out the kind with the details of your Event: Post an image or video to your Event, the recommended photo dimensions are 1920 × 1080 pixels. Fill out the Event name, day, area, as well as a summary. You can likewise choose whether visitors could invite various other visitors as well as whether or not the guest listing will certainly show up to others.

- Click Create.

When the Event is created, you could welcome visitors, share posts to the Event web page, and also edit your Event details after the truth-- other than obviously the privacy setups.

Public vs. Private Events on Facebook

There are three main distinctions in between public as well as private Events:

- Public Events can be hosted by a Facebook page you manage, whereas you will certainly have to use your individual profile to host personal Events.

- You can select publishing privileges to the web page with public Events but not with personal Events.

- In addition to adding a photo or video clip, private Event hosts can additionally pick one of Facebook's pre-made motifs offered for all sorts of various Events: birthdays, celebrations, traveling, vacations, and also extra.

Profile vs. Page Hosting on Facebook

For public Events, there are a few distinctions in between Events organized using your individual profile and also those utilizing a Facebook page you handle.

Events that are hosted by a Facebook web page could add multiple days to their Events. (You can additionally make it a persisting Event on a day-to-day, once a week, or custom regularity.

You can add a classification, keywords, mark it as child pleasant, add a web link for tickets, and include cohosts. Cohosts will need to authorize your request to be added to the Event, and also can be various other Facebook web pages or individuals. Groups and key words are important for public Events so that your Event can be discovered by Facebook individuals who have shared interest in these things in the past.
